Surber Barber Choate & Hertlein Architects designed the 35,000 square foot clubhouse at North Hampton Golf Club in the mountains of Akita, Japan. The club features an 18-hole golf course designed by renowned Japanese course designer Takeaki Kaneda.
Dining facilities include a formal dining room and bar, casual dining room, three private dining rooms, a trophy room and bar, a full-service kitchen, and serving kitchens on the first and second floors.
Locker room facilities include traditional Japanese bathing rooms overlooking private gardens, a massage room, sauna, a V.I.P. locker room, and additional lockers and facilities for 136 men and 32 women. The clubhouse also contains a pro shop and cart storage for approximately 60 golf carts.
Client: Mr. Junkichi Aoyama
Completion: 1995
